Concrete damage repair services address issues such as cracks, spalling, uneven surfaces, and other forms of deterioration that can compromise the integrity and appearance of concrete structures. These repairs typically cover a variety of projects including driveways, sidewalks, patios, garage floors, and foundation slabs. Property owners often seek this service to restore safety, improve curb appeal, and prevent further damage that could lead to more costly repairs down the line. Before requesting concrete damage repair, it’s helpful to understand the extent of the damage, the underlying causes, and the desired outcome to ensure the repair process effectively addresses the specific issues.
Understanding the types of damage common in concrete surfaces can assist property owners in making informed decisions. For instance, cracks may result from settling or temperature changes, while surface spalling could be caused by freeze-thaw cycles or poor initial mixing. Clarifying whether repairs are needed for aesthetic reasons or structural integrity can influence the approach taken. Property owners should also consider the age of the concrete and any ongoing environmental factors that might affect the durability of repairs, ensuring that the chosen solution provides a long-lasting result suited to the specific project.

Common Concrete Damage Repair Jobs
Crack Repair - filling and sealing surface cracks to restore stability and prevent further damage.
Surface Resurfacing - applying new finishes to improve appearance and protect against future wear.
Spalling Repair - removing damaged concrete caused by freeze-thaw cycles and applying durable patches.
Structural Reinforcement - strengthening compromised concrete to support ongoing load requirements.
Joint Restoration - repairing or replacing expansion joints to prevent water infiltration and cracking.
Concrete Cleaning - removing stains, dirt, and debris to maintain concrete integrity and appearance.
Concrete Damage Repair Questions
What types of concrete damage can be repaired? Common issues include cracking, spalling, and uneven surfaces that can be restored for safety and appearance.
How is concrete damage typically repaired? Repairs often involve patching, sealing cracks, or resurfacing to restore structural integrity and improve look.
Can damaged concrete be prevented in the future? Proper maintenance, sealing, and addressing drainage issues help reduce the risk of future damage.
What surfaces can be repaired with concrete damage services? Driveways, sidewalks, patios, and garage floors are common surfaces that can benefit from repair services.
